国产av日韩一区二区三区精品,成人性爱视频在线观看,国产,欧美,日韩,一区,www.成色av久久成人,2222eeee成人天堂

Inhaltsverzeichnis
Was minmax() tats?chlich tut
Wann zu verwenden minmax() - gemeinsame Szenarien
Wie man minmax() mit anderen Werten kombiniert
Ein paar Gotchas und Tipps
Heim Web-Frontend Front-End-Fragen und Antworten Wie kann die Minmax () -Funktion von CSS Grid verwendet werden, um flexible Gitterspuren zu erstellen?

Wie kann die Minmax () -Funktion von CSS Grid verwendet werden, um flexible Gitterspuren zu erstellen?

Jun 07, 2025 am 12:12 AM
CSS Grid minmax()

Die Minmax () -Funktion von CSS wird verwendet, um den minimalen und maximalen Gr??enbereich von Gitterspuren zu definieren, wodurch die Layout -Flexibilit?t verbessert wird. Die Kernfunktion besteht darin, den Entwickler ein Gr??enintervall wie Minmax (200px, 1FR) anzugeben, bedeutet, dass die S?ulenbreite mindestens 200px betr?gt und h?chstens auf 1FR gestreckt werden kann. Zu den allgemeinen Verwendungen geh?ren Responsive -Karten -Layout, automatische Spaltenbreitenanpassung von Datentabellen und ausgewogene Leerbereiche. Zu den h?ufig verwendeten Kombinationen geh?ren Minmax (200px, 1FR), Minmax (Minmax-In-Content, Max-In-In-Inhalt), Minmax (150px, 300px) und Minmax (Auto, 1FR). Zu den Hinweisen geh?ren das Vermeiden von zu hohem Mindesteinstellungen, das Testen verschiedener Bildschirmbreitenleistung und die Verwendung von Entwickler -Tools, um das Verhalten zu überprüfen. Die rationale Verwendung von Minmax () kann die Implementierung des reaktionsschnellen Designs effektiv vereinfachen.

Die Verwendung von CSS Grid's minmax() -Funktion ist eine der besten M?glichkeiten, um Ihr Gitterlayout Flexibilit?t zu geben, ohne eine Reihe zus?tzlicher Medienfragen oder JavaScript zu schreiben. Sie k?nnen einen Bereich für die Gr??e eines Tracks definieren und im Grunde genommen sagen: "Ich m?chte, dass diese Spalte (oder Zeile) mindestens x ist, aber nicht mehr als y ." Das macht es sehr nützlich, wenn es reaktionsschnelle Layouts aufbaut.

Was minmax() tats?chlich tut

In seinem Kern fordert minmax(min, max) dem Browser an, eine Gitterspur zwischen zwei Werten zugr??en. Der erste Wert ist die minimale akzeptable Gr??e und der zweite der Maximum. Wenn Platz vorhanden ist, wird die Strecke zu diesem Maximum heran. Wenn der Platz eng wird, schrumpft er auf die Minute.

Normalerweise sehen Sie es in den grid-template-columns oder grid-template-rows wie folgt:

 .Netz {
  Anzeige: Grid;
  Grid-Template-S?ulen: Wiederholung (Auto-Fit, Minmax (200px, 1fr));
}

In diesem Beispiel ist jede Spalte mindestens 200px breit, aber wenn es Platz gibt, strecken sie sich gleichm??ig mit 1fr aus.

Wann zu verwenden minmax() - gemeinsame Szenarien

Hier sind einige typische Anwendungsf?lle, in denen minmax() leuchtet:

  • Responsive Kartenlayouts - wie Produktlisten oder Bildgalerien.
  • Automatische Spalten in Datentabellen -damit der Inhalt nicht überflutet oder unbeholfen zusammenfasst.
  • Einbalancieren des wei?en Raums - besonders wenn man sich mit ungleichm??igen Inhaltsl?ngen befasst.

Es ist besonders praktisch, wenn es in der Funktion repeat() mit auto-fit oder auto-fill kombiniert wird.

Wie man minmax() mit anderen Werten kombiniert

Die Kraft von minmax() zeigt wirklich, wenn Sie es mit anderen CSS -Gr??eneinheiten mischen. Hier sind einige gemeinsame Kombinationen:

  • minmax(200px, 1fr) - Gut, um Karten zu dehnen und gleichzeitig eine minimale Breite zu führen.
  • minmax(min-content, max-content) -extremer; Lassen Sie uns den Inhalt von Gr??en extremen diktieren.
  • minmax(150px, 300px) - CAPS beide Enden, ideal für strenge Designsysteme.
  • minmax(auto, 1fr) - Lassen Sie den Browser das Minimum basierend auf Inhalten entscheiden.

Eine Sache, auf die Sie achten sollten: Die Verwendung von minmax(auto, 1fr) verhalten sich m?glicherweise nicht genau, wie Sie es erwarten, da auto je nach Inhalt und Containergr??e variieren kann. Es lohnt sich visuell zu testen.

Ein paar Gotchas und Tipps

Wie jeder CSS -Trick hat minmax() ein paar Macken:

  • Vermeiden Sie überm??ig aggressive Minengr??en - Wenn Sie ein hohes Minimum festlegen und der Beh?lter nicht erweitern kann, k?nnen sich die Dinge durchbrechen oder überlaufen.
  • Testen Sie verschiedene Bildschirmbreiten - nur weil es auf Desktop funktioniert, hei?t das nicht, dass es auf dem Handy gut aussieht.
  • Verwenden Sie Dev Tools, um das Verhalten zu überprüfen - manchmal ist es nicht offensichtlich, warum eine S?ule schrumpft oder dehnt.

Denken Sie auch daran, dass minmax() nur die spezifische Spur beeinflusst, auf die sie angewendet wird. Wenn Sie mehrere Spuren haben, respektiert jeder seine eigenen Regeln, sofern dies nicht durch das Gesamtlayout eingeschr?nkt wird.

Grunds?tzlich ist das. Sobald Sie den Dreh raus haben, wird minmax() zu einem dieser Anlaufstellen, damit sich die Netze ohne gro?e Anstrengungen klug und adaptiv anfühlen.

Das obige ist der detaillierte Inhalt vonWie kann die Minmax () -Funktion von CSS Grid verwendet werden, um flexible Gitterspuren zu erstellen?. Für weitere Informationen folgen Sie bitte anderen verwandten Artikeln auf der PHP chinesischen Website!

Erkl?rung dieser Website
Der Inhalt dieses Artikels wird freiwillig von Internetnutzern beigesteuert und das Urheberrecht liegt beim ursprünglichen Autor. Diese Website übernimmt keine entsprechende rechtliche Verantwortung. Wenn Sie Inhalte finden, bei denen der Verdacht eines Plagiats oder einer Rechtsverletzung besteht, wenden Sie sich bitte an admin@php.cn

Hei?e KI -Werkzeuge

Undress AI Tool

Undress AI Tool

Ausziehbilder kostenlos

Undresser.AI Undress

Undresser.AI Undress

KI-gestützte App zum Erstellen realistischer Aktfotos

AI Clothes Remover

AI Clothes Remover

Online-KI-Tool zum Entfernen von Kleidung aus Fotos.

Clothoff.io

Clothoff.io

KI-Kleiderentferner

Video Face Swap

Video Face Swap

Tauschen Sie Gesichter in jedem Video mühelos mit unserem v?llig kostenlosen KI-Gesichtstausch-Tool aus!

Hei?e Werkzeuge

Notepad++7.3.1

Notepad++7.3.1

Einfach zu bedienender und kostenloser Code-Editor

SublimeText3 chinesische Version

SublimeText3 chinesische Version

Chinesische Version, sehr einfach zu bedienen

Senden Sie Studio 13.0.1

Senden Sie Studio 13.0.1

Leistungsstarke integrierte PHP-Entwicklungsumgebung

Dreamweaver CS6

Dreamweaver CS6

Visuelle Webentwicklungstools

SublimeText3 Mac-Version

SublimeText3 Mac-Version

Codebearbeitungssoftware auf Gottesniveau (SublimeText3)

CSS Grid vs Flexbox: Codevergleich CSS Grid vs Flexbox: Codevergleich Jun 01, 2025 am 12:03 AM

CSSGrid und Flexbox k?nnen in Kombination verwendet werden, aber das Gitter eignet sich besser für zweidimensionale Layouts, w?hrend Flexbox bei eindimensionalen Layouts gut ist. 1.Grid definiert die Gitterstruktur durch Raster-Template-Reihen und Gitter-Template-S?ulen, die für komplexe zweidimensionale Layouts geeignet sind. 2. Flexbox steuert die Richtung und die Platzallokation durch Flex-Richtung- und Flex-Attribute, geeignet für eindimensionales Layout und einfaches reagierendes Design. 3. In Bezug auf die Leistung ist Flexbox für einfache Layouts geeignet und das Gitter für komplexe Layouts geeignet, kann jedoch die Leistung des Browsers beeinflussen. 4. Kompatibilit?t, Flexbox unterstützt ein umfassenderes Netz in modernen Browsern

Wie kann die Minmax () -Funktion von CSS Grid verwendet werden, um flexible Gitterspuren zu erstellen? Wie kann die Minmax () -Funktion von CSS Grid verwendet werden, um flexible Gitterspuren zu erstellen? Jun 07, 2025 am 12:12 AM

Die Minmax () -Funktion von CSS wird verwendet, um den minimalen und maximalen Gr??enbereich von Gitterspuren zu definieren, wodurch die Layout -Flexibilit?t verbessert wird. Die Kernfunktion besteht darin, den Entwickler ein Gr??enintervall wie Minmax (200px, 1FR) anzugeben, bedeutet, dass die S?ulenbreite mindestens 200px betr?gt und h?chstens auf 1FR gestreckt werden kann. Zu den allgemeinen Verwendungen geh?ren Responsive -Karten -Layout, automatische Spaltenbreitenanpassung von Datentabellen und ausgewogene Leerbereiche. Zu den h?ufig verwendeten Kombinationen geh?ren Minmax (200px, 1FR), Minmax (Minmax-In-Content, Max-In-In-Inhalt), Minmax (150px, 300px) und Minmax (Auto, 1FR). Zu den Anmerkungen geh?ren das Vermeiden der Einstellung zu hoher Mindestwerte und das Testen verschiedener Bildschirme

Was sind die Vorteile der Verwendung von CSS-Gitter für komplexe zweidimensionale Seitenlayouts? Was sind die Vorteile der Verwendung von CSS-Gitter für komplexe zweidimensionale Seitenlayouts? Jun 12, 2025 am 10:28 AM

CSSGRIDISAPOWURTOOLTOOLFORCORATECORECYNEXTWO-DIMEALALLAYOUTOUTOutsByFeringControloverbothrowsAndColumns.

Was sind FR -Einheiten im CSS -Netz? Was sind FR -Einheiten im CSS -Netz? Jun 22, 2025 am 12:46 AM

ThefrunitincsSgriddistributesAvailableSpaceProphortal.

K?nnen Sie einen Flexbox -Beh?lter in einem CSS -Netzelement nisten? K?nnen Sie einen Flexbox -Beh?lter in einem CSS -Netzelement nisten? Jun 22, 2025 am 12:40 AM

Ja, Sie k?nnen Flexbox in CSSGrid -Elementen verwenden. Der spezifische Ansatz besteht darin, zun?chst die Seitenstruktur mit dem Gitter zu teilen und den Unterkontainer als Flex -Beh?lter in eine Gitterzelle zu setzen, um eine weitere feine Ausrichtung und Anordnung zu erzielen. Zum Beispiel nisten ein Div mit Display: Flex -Stil in HTML; Zu den Vorteilen, dies zu tun, geh?ren hierarchisches Layout, einfacher reaktionsschnelles Design und freundlichere Komponentenentwicklung. Es ist zu beachten, dass das Display -Attribut nur direkte Kinderelemente beeinflusst, überm??ige Verschachtelung vermieden und die Kompatibilit?tsprobleme alter Browser berücksichtigt.

Was ist CSS Grid Layout? Was ist CSS Grid Layout? Jun 23, 2025 am 12:13 AM

CSSGrid ist ein zweidimensionales Web-Layout-Tool, mit dem Entwickler die Position und Gr??e von Seitenelementen durch Definieren von Zeilen und Spalten genau steuern k?nnen. Im Gegensatz zu Flexbox kann es gleichzeitig Zeilen und Spalten verarbeiten, die zum Aufbau komplexer Strukturen geeignet sind. Um das Raster zu verwenden, müssen Sie zuerst den Container auf das Anzeigen einstellen: Grid und die Spaltengr??e durch 1.Grid-Template-S?ulen und 2. GRID-TEMPLATE-Reihen, den Abstand und den 4. GRID-TEMPLATE-benannten Bereich einstellen, um die Lesbarkeit zu verbessern. Zu den typischen Anwendungsszenarien geh?ren Responsive Layouts, Dashboard -Schnittstellen und Bildgalerien. Zu den praktischen Tipps geh?ren: 5. Grid-S?ule/g verwenden

So verwenden Sie CSS Grid und Flexbox Tutorial zusammen mit Tutorial So verwenden Sie CSS Grid und Flexbox Tutorial zusammen mit Tutorial Jun 27, 2025 am 12:40 AM

CSSGrid und Flexbox haben jeweils ein eigenes Fachwissen, und die besten Ergebnisse werden zusammen verwendet. Grid ist ein zweidimensionales Layout, das für die Gesamtseitenstruktur geeignet ist, z. Flexbox ist ein eindimensionales Layout, das eher für die interne Anordnung von Komponenten geeignet ist, z. B. Navigationsleiste, Tastegruppe, Kartenliste usw. Verwenden Sie beispielsweise das Gitter in der Mitte des Dreispalten-Layouts und blockieren dann nach oben und unten und verwenden Sie mit Flexbox mehrere Tasten in einer Reihe automatisch aus. Die tats?chliche Kombinationsmethode lautet: Der ?u?ere Container verwendet Anzeige: Grid, um das Gesamtgerüst zu definieren, und die untergeordneten Elemente werden in jedem Bereich mit Display: Flex angeordnet. Zu den allgemeinen Strukturen geh?ren die gesamte Seite mit dem Gitter, um Bl?cke zu teilen, und die Navigationsleiste, die Schaltfl?chengruppe und die Kartenliste sind mit Flexbox ausgerichtet. Notiz

Wie platziere ich Elemente in einem CSS -Netz mit Zeilennummern? Wie platziere ich Elemente in einem CSS -Netz mit Zeilennummern? Jun 25, 2025 am 12:36 AM

ToplaceItemSonacssgridusinnenumbers, youspecifyThestartandendlinesForrowsandColumns.1) GridlinesAreAutomatisch-startingfrom1atThetop-linftcorner, withverticallinesseParatingColumnsandhorizinitorinationParatingrowns.2) Gebrauch

See all articles